快速构建高效语言模型
在当今信息爆炸的时代,自然语言处理(NLP)技术的应用已经渗透到了我们生活的方方面面,三连词语的运用不仅极大地提升了语言表达的效率,还为机器学习和人工智能的发展提供了强大的支持,本文将详细介绍如何使用三连词语来构建高效的NLP模型,并提供一系列具体的例子。
什么是三连词语?
三连词语是指三个或多个连续出现的词汇,通常用于表示时间、地点或因果关系。“昨天下午三点”、“他去了上海”等,这些词语通过紧凑的组合,能够迅速传达出特定的时间点、空间位置或因果关系。
如何使用三连词语构建高效NLP模型?
1、数据预处理:需要对文本进行预处理,包括去除停用词、分词、词干化等步骤,以便于后续的分析。
2、特征提取:使用三连词语作为特征进行特征提取,可以通过自定义函数或者利用现有的工具库来实现。
3、模型训练:使用提取到的特征和标签进行模型训练,常见的模型如朴素贝叶斯、逻辑回归、支持向量机等都可以被用来处理这种类型的数据。
4、模型评估:在训练完成后,需要对模型进行评估,以确定其性能,常用的评价指标包括准确率、召回率、F1分数等。
具体案例
假设我们要构建一个基于三连词语的问答系统,可以按照以下步骤进行:
1、数据收集:收集大量包含三连词语的问题和答案数据。
2、数据预处理:使用Python中的nltk
库对文本进行分词和去停用词处理。
3、特征提取:使用三连词语作为特征,编写自定义函数进行特征提取。
4、模型训练:使用训练好的模型对新问题进行回答。
5、模型评估:使用测试集对模型进行评估,调整模型参数以提高性能。
通过以上步骤,我们可以有效地利用三连词语来构建高效、准确的语言模型,这种方法不仅提高了数据处理的效率,还使得模型更加贴近人类的语法规则和习惯,从而在各种应用场景中展现出卓越的表现。
三连词语作为一种强大的语言工具,已经在NLP领域得到了广泛的应用,通过合理的设计和使用,我们可以高效地构建出既具有强大功能又易于操作的NLP模型,随着技术的进步,相信三连词语将会在更多领域发挥更大的作用,推动自然语言处理技术的发展和应用。